Aquagold is a patented luxury micro-infusion treatment that delivers a custom cocktail of therapeutic ingredients directly into the superficial layer of the skin. Using 20 ultra-fine, 24-karat gold-plated needles, this device precisely infuses a personalized blend of ingredients like hyaluronic acid, “micro-Botox,” and essential nutrients to hydrate, shrink pores, and create an immediate, luminous glow.

What to Expect: Your Results Timeline
- Immediately After Treatment: You will notice an immediate, dewy glow and a feeling of deep hydration. Your skin may appear slightly pink, which typically subsides within an hour or two.
- The First Week: This is when the “micro-Botox” and other ingredients begin to take full effect. You will see a visible reduction in pore size, a decrease in oil production, and an overall smoother, more refined skin texture.
- One Month & Beyond: Your “glass skin” results will be in full effect, with optimal radiance and smoothness. Results typically last for 3-4 months. We recommend a series of treatments or quarterly maintenance sessions to sustain and compound these benefits.

Is Aquagold Painful?
Aquagold is exceptionally comfortable and virtually painless. The needles are thinner than a human hair and penetrate at a very superficial depth. Most patients describe the sensation as a light, “stamping” feeling. Unlike other microneedling treatments, numbing cream is typically not required, making it a true “lunchtime” procedure that aligns with our gentle, nurturing approach.
How Does Aquagold Compare to Traditional Microneedling?
This is an excellent question. Traditional microneedling (collagen induction therapy) uses solid needles to create deeper micro-injuries in the skin, which triggers a wound-healing response to build collagen over time. Serums are applied on top of the skin afterward.
Aquagold is a micro-infusion treatment. Its primary goal is not to create injury but to deliver a custom serum into the skin via its hollow needles. It works more superficially to improve texture, pores, and hydration for an immediate glow. Microneedling is generally better for deeper scars, while Aquagold is superior for improving “glass skin” texture and radiance with no downtime.
How Many Sessions Will I Need?
While a single Aquagold treatment will deliver a beautiful, radiant glow perfect for an event, we find that the best results come from a series. For optimal skin rejuvenation, we typically recommend an initial series of 2-3 treatments, spaced about 4-6 weeks apart. After that, many of our patients return every 3-4 months for a maintenance treatment to keep their skin luminous and healthy year-round.
